2026년 최고의 CI/CD 도구: GitHub Actions vs GitLab CI vs CircleCI vs ArgoCD
(dev.to)
202나 2026년 기준 주요 CI/CD 도구인 GitHub Actions, GitLab CI, CircleCI, ArgoCD의 특징과 용도를 비교 분석한 글입니다. 프로젝트의 인프라 환경, 개발 생태계, 예산 및 파이프라인 복잡도에 따른 최적의 도구 선택 가이드를 제공합니다.
이 글의 핵심 포인트
- 1GitHub Actions: 20,000개 이상의 액션 마켓플레이스를 보유한 가장 대중적인 도구
- 2GitLab CI: 컨테이너 레지스트리, 보안 스캐닝 등 통합 DevOps 기능을 제공하는 올인원 플랫폼
- 3CircleCI: 월 6,000분의 가장 넉넉한 무료 티어와 강력한 캐싱 성능을 통한 빠른 빌드 속도
- 4ArgoCD: Kubernetes 환경에 특화된 GitOps 도구로, Git을 단일 진실 공급원(Single Source of Truth)으로 활용
- 5도구 선택의 핵심 기준: 프로젝트 호스팅 위치, 인프라 구조(K8s 여부), 예산 및 파이프한 복잡도
이 글에 대한 공공지능 분석
왜 중요한가
소프트웨어 개발의 핵심인 CI/CD 파이프라인 구축은 제품의 출시 속도(Time-to-Market)와 운영 안정성을 결정짓는 결정적인 요소입니다. 잘못된 도구 선택은 불필요한 운영 비용 증가와 개발 생산성 저하를 초래할 수 있습니다.
배경과 맥락
클라우드 네이티브 환경과 Kubernetes 도입이 보편화됨에 따라, 단순 배포를 넘어 GitOps(ArgoCD)나 통합 DevOps 플랫폼(GitLab)에 대한 요구가 커지고 있습니다. 또한, 개발자 경험(DX)을 극대화하기 위해 기존 코드 호스팅 서비스와의 통합 수준이 도구 선택의 핵심 기준이 되고 있습니다.
업계 영향
GitHub Actions와 같은 강력한 생태계를 가진 도구가 시장을 주도하는 가운데, 보안과 컴플라이언스가 중요한 기업은 GitLab CI를, 복잡한 병렬 처리가 필요한 대규모 프로젝트는 CircleCI를 선택하는 등 도구의 전문화가 가속화될 것입니다. 또한, Kubernetes 환경에서는 ArgoCD를 통한 GitOps가 표준으로 자리 잡고 있습니다.
한국 시장 시사점
빠른 실험과 피보팅이 생존 전략인 한국 스타트업은 GitHub Actions의 방대한 마켓플레이스를 활용해 초기 인프라 구축 비용을 최소화해야 합니다. 반면, 서비스 규모가 커지며 MSA(마이크로서비스 아키텍처)로 전환하는 성장기 기업은 ArgoCD 도입을 통해 운영 복잡도를 관리하는 전략적 전환이 필요합니다.
이 글에 대한 큐레이터 의견
스타트업 창업자와 CTO에게 CI/CD 도구 선택은 단순한 기술적 결정을 넘어 '엔지니어링 비용(OpEx)'과 '개발 속도' 사이의 전략적 트레이드오프(Trade-off)입니다. 초기 단계에서는 별도의 학습 곡선이 낮고 기존 GitHub 생태계를 그대로 활용할 수 있는 GitHub Actions를 선택하여, 인프라 관리보다는 제품 기능 개발에 리소스를 집중하는 것이 가장 현명한 전략입니다.
하지만 서비스가 성장하여 Kubernetes 기반의 복잡한 인프라를 운영하게 된다면, ArgoCD와 같은 GitOps 도구 도입을 피할 수 없습니다. 이때 주의할 점은 '도구의 파편화'입니다. 너무 많은 특화 도구는 관리 포인트(Management Overhead)를 늘려 오히려 개발팀의 병목을 유발할 수 있으므로, 팀의 인프라 숙련도와 인력 규모를 고려하여 단계적으로 파이프라인을 고도화하는 실행 가능한 로드맵을 설계해야 합니다.
관련 뉴스
댓글
아직 댓글이 없습니다. 첫 댓글을 남겨보세요.